Hill Clearing in Cumming, GA
Hill clearing services involve the removal of trees, brush, and other vegetation to prepare a property for construction, landscaping, or improved accessibility. These services are commonly requested for projects such as building new homes, installing driveways, creating open fields, or clearing land for agricultural purposes. Property owners typically want to understand the extent of clearing needed, the types of vegetation involved, and any potential impact on the land’s drainage or stability before requesting assistance.
Before requesting hill clearing, property owners should consider the scope of the project, including whether partial or complete removal of trees and brush is necessary. It’s also helpful to evaluate the land’s topography and any local regulations that may influence clearing activities. Clear communication about the desired outcome and understanding the land’s features can ensure the work aligns with the project goals and property conditions.

Common Hill Clearing Jobs
Brush clearing - removes overgrown vegetation to improve yard appearance and accessibility.
Tree and shrub removal - eliminates hazardous or unwanted trees and bushes safely.
Lot clearing - prepares land for construction, gardening, or landscaping projects.
Stump grinding - removes remaining tree stumps to create a smooth, safe surface.
Debris removal - clears away fallen branches, logs, and other yard waste.
Firebreak creation - clears vegetation to help prevent the spread of wildfires.
Hill Clearing Questions
What is hill clearing? Hill clearing involves removing trees, shrubs, and debris from sloped land to create a level area for development or landscaping.
What types of projects require hill clearing? Projects like building a new home, installing a driveway, or creating a level yard on hilly terrain often need hill clearing services.
Is hill clearing suitable for all types of terrain? Hill clearing is effective on most sloped or uneven land, but the extent of work depends on the land’s condition and desired outcome.
What should property owners consider before hill clearing? It’s important to evaluate land stability, drainage, and future use plans when planning hill clearing projects.
